Grenade

Recipe information

  • Yield

    <p>Makes 4 Cups</p>

Ingredients

about 1 1/2 pomegranates
3/4 cup dark rum
1/2 cup grenadine
1/4 cup fresh lime juice
1 cup club soda or seltzer
ice cubes

Preparation

  1. Cut whole pomegranate in half and with a manual citrus juicer squeeze enough juice from halves, pressing sides against center of juicer and pressing on any whole seeds in juicer with thumbs, to measure 1 cup. Just before serving, in a 1 1/2 quart pitcher stir together pomegranate juice, remaining ingredients, and enough ice to fill pitcher.
